Precise measurement of the Y(4260) particle at the Beijing spectrometer BESIII

  • Using 9fb-1 data collected with the BESIII spectrometer at the Beijing Electron Positron Collider II storage ring, the production cross section of the e+e→ππJ/ψ process was measured. We observed the Y(4260) resonance and measured its parameters with the best precision to date in the world. Our measurement shows that the mass of Y(4260) is around 4.22 GeV/c2 and its width is about 44 MeV, which are lower and much narrower, respectively, than previous measurements. BESIII's precise measurement sets a tighter constraint on the interpretation of the Y(4260) internal structure models compared with previous experiments. In ddition, BESIII also observed a new resonance near 4.32 GeV/c2, with a statistical significance of 7.6σ. The mass and width of this resonance agree with the Y(4360) state within experimental error.
